Transaction e286f50cbb5224ed3c191b54f306c56c92f95259fde9f22c5a3946fc85158998

1 Input
2 Outputs
  • e286f50cbb5224ed3c191b54f306c56c92f95259fde9f22c5a3946fc85158998:0
  • value  19443000
    address  3Jwpygaih2TjkgWSDsvCYFfUUaEuAMS3YL
  • e286f50cbb5224ed3c191b54f306c56c92f95259fde9f22c5a3946fc85158998:1
  • value  2886114
    address  1LEbv6SVrdKt44hFBcEK12HGq9htfmf3KW